| import argparse | |
| import os | |
| from warnings import warn | |
| from time import sleep | |
| import tensorflow as tf | |
| from hparams import hparams | |
| from infolog import log | |
| from tacotron.synthesize import tacotron_synthesize | |
| from wavenet_vocoder.synthesize import wavenet_synthesize | |
| def prepare_run(args): | |
| modified_hp = hparams.parse(args.hparams) | |
| os.environ['TF_CPP_MIN_LOG_LEVEL'] = '2' | |
| run_name = args.name or args.tacotron_name or args.model | |
| taco_checkpoint = os.path.join('logs-' + run_name, 'taco_' + args.checkpoint) | |
| run_name = args.name or args.wavenet_name or args.model | |
| wave_checkpoint = os.path.join('logs-' + run_name, 'wave_' + args.checkpoint) | |
| return taco_checkpoint, wave_checkpoint, modified_hp | |
| def get_sentences(args): | |
| if args.text_list != '': | |
| with open(args.text_list, 'rb') as f: | |
| sentences = list(map(lambda l: l.decode("utf-8")[:-1], f.readlines())) | |
| else: | |
| sentences = hparams.sentences | |
| return sentences | |
| def synthesize(args, hparams, taco_checkpoint, wave_checkpoint, sentences): | |
| log('Running End-to-End TTS Evaluation. Model: {}'.format(args.name or args.model)) | |
| log('Synthesizing mel-spectrograms from text..') | |
| wavenet_in_dir = tacotron_synthesize(args, hparams, taco_checkpoint, sentences) | |
| #Delete Tacotron model from graph | |
| tf.reset_default_graph() | |
| #Sleep 1/2 second to let previous graph close and avoid error messages while Wavenet is synthesizing | |
| sleep(0.5) | |
| log('Synthesizing audio from mel-spectrograms.. (This may take a while)') | |
| wavenet_synthesize(args, hparams, wave_checkpoint) | |
| log('Tacotron-2 TTS synthesis complete!') | |
| def main(): | |
| accepted_modes = ['eval', 'synthesis', 'live'] | |
| parser = argparse.ArgumentParser() | |
| parser.add_argument('--checkpoint', default='pretrained/', help='Path to model checkpoint') | |
| parser.add_argument('--hparams', default='', | |
| help='Hyperparameter overrides as a comma-separated list of name=value pairs') | |
| parser.add_argument('--name', help='Name of logging directory if the two models were trained together.') | |
| parser.add_argument('--tacotron_name', help='Name of logging directory of Tacotron. If trained separately') | |
| parser.add_argument('--wavenet_name', help='Name of logging directory of WaveNet. If trained separately') | |
| parser.add_argument('--model', default='Tacotron-2') | |
| parser.add_argument('--input_dir', default='training_data/', help='folder to contain inputs sentences/targets') | |
| parser.add_argument('--mels_dir', default='tacotron_output/eval/', help='folder to contain mels to synthesize audio from using the Wavenet') | |
| parser.add_argument('--output_dir', default='output/', help='folder to contain synthesized mel spectrograms') | |
| parser.add_argument('--mode', default='eval', help='mode of run: can be one of {}'.format(accepted_modes)) | |
| parser.add_argument('--GTA', default='True', help='Ground truth aligned synthesis, defaults to True, only considered in synthesis mode') | |
| parser.add_argument('--text_list', default='', help='Text file contains list of texts to be synthesized. Valid if mode=eval') | |
| parser.add_argument('--speaker_id', default=None, help='Defines the speakers ids to use when running standalone Wavenet on a folder of mels. this variable must be a comma-separated list of ids') | |
| args = parser.parse_args() | |
| accepted_models = ['Tacotron', 'WaveNet', 'Tacotron-2'] | |
| if args.model not in accepted_models: | |
| raise ValueError('please enter a valid model to synthesize with: {}'.format(accepted_models)) | |
| if args.mode not in accepted_modes: | |
| raise ValueError('accepted modes are: {}, found {}'.format(accepted_modes, args.mode)) | |
| if args.mode == 'live' and args.model == 'Wavenet': | |
| raise RuntimeError('Wavenet vocoder cannot be tested live due to its slow generation. Live only works with Tacotron!') | |
| if args.GTA not in ('True', 'False'): | |
| raise ValueError('GTA option must be either True or False') | |
| if args.model == 'Tacotron-2': | |
| if args.mode == 'live': | |
| warn('Requested a live evaluation with Tacotron-2, Wavenet will not be used!') | |
| if args.mode == 'synthesis': | |
| raise ValueError('I don\'t recommend running WaveNet on entire dataset.. The world might end before the synthesis :) (only eval allowed)') | |
| taco_checkpoint, wave_checkpoint, hparams = prepare_run(args) | |
| sentences = get_sentences(args) | |
| if args.model == 'Tacotron': | |
| _ = tacotron_synthesize(args, hparams, taco_checkpoint, sentences) | |
| elif args.model == 'WaveNet': | |
| wavenet_synthesize(args, hparams, wave_checkpoint) | |
| elif args.model == 'Tacotron-2': | |
| synthesize(args, hparams, taco_checkpoint, wave_checkpoint, sentences) | |
| else: | |
| raise ValueError('Model provided {} unknown! {}'.format(args.model, accepted_models)) | |
| if __name__ == '__main__': | |
| main() |
